Prohibition Tightens in Iowa as New Laws Pass

Iowa enacts nine new prohibition measures including the stringent canned heat ban and a dump law. Attorney General Gilson confirms enforcement, with laws taking effect except canned heat. Superintendent McNaught notes the push to curb illegal beverage practices and bootlegging.

Patriotic Lexingon Concord stamps on sale for anniversary

A three stamp series marks the 150th anniversary of the Lexington Concord battle and a half cent stamp, with denominations of one two and five cents. The one cent shows Washington at the Cambridge elm, the two cent depicts the Lexington battle, and the five cent reproduces the Concord Minute Man statue with Emerson verse.

Harding Memorial to Be Built Soon

The $600,000 Harding Memorial project will commence immediately on a site near Marion Ohio. The committee reports $800,000 available for the work with $100,000 reserved for perpetual maintenance. Additional notes reference other historical items and unrelated incidents.

Critics Debunk Franklin Electric Myth Claim

The International Benjamin Franklin Society refutes a professor's claim that Franklin's kite experiment was mythical. It presents common knowledge evidence supporting the kite and key discovery of electricity and notes many have repeated similar experiments without fatal outcomes, as Illinois State Journal reports.
